Frequently Asked Questions
What are the main trade school options for Caribou, ME residents, and are there any located directly in the city?
The primary trade school serving Caribou directly is Northern Maine Community College (NMCC), located in Presque Isle just a short drive away. For secondary students and adults, the Region 2 School of Applied Technology, based in Houlton, also serves Aroostook County. While Caribou itself doesn't host a large standalone trade campus, NMCC is the central hub for vocational training in the region.
Which trade programs at Northern Maine Community College are most in-demand by local Aroostook County employers?
Programs like Electrical Lineworker, Welding Technology, and HVAC-R are highly sought after due to infrastructure and construction needs in the region. Automotive Technology and Carpentry also have strong local demand for maintaining vehicles and supporting residential and commercial building projects throughout the county.
Are there any unique apprenticeship or earn-while-you-learn opportunities specific to trades in the Caribou area?
Yes, many local employers in construction, logging, and public utilities partner with NMCC for structured apprenticeships. The Electrical Lineworker program, in particular, has direct pathways with utility companies in Northern Maine. Students should contact the NMCC Career Services office and local unions to explore specific earn-while-you-learn options available each semester.
What certifications can I earn through trade programs at Northern Maine Community College that are recognized by Maine employers?
NMCC programs lead to industry-recognized certifications such as OSHA safety credentials, EPA 608 Certification for HVAC-R technicians, and AWS welding certifications. Graduates from the Electrical Lineworker program earn certificates that qualify them for entry-level positions with utility companies, while automotive students can pursue ASE preparation.
How does the job placement process work for trade school graduates in the Caribou and greater Aroostook County region?
Northern Maine Community College has a strong career services department that connects graduates with local employers through job fairs, interviews, and direct referrals. Many regional employers in construction, manufacturing, healthcare, and energy sectors actively recruit from NMCC. Networking through instructors and local trade associations is also highly effective for finding opportunities in this tight-knit community.
